An unappealing stench coming from an apartment block alerted neighbours to a dead body. 

Police were called to the Beach Prd unit in Maroochydore, on the Sunshine Coast about 8am on Tuesday. 

Neighbours reported a strong smell coming from one of the units and a dead body was found, The Courier Mail reported.

The unit’s door was left ajar and police believe the deceased individual had been dead for some time. 

Police spoke to neighbours asking if they had seen anything suspicious. 

A Queensland Police spokesman told Daily Mail Australia that the death is non-suspicious.
